Redis全方位作用总结 -Vedcraft


Redis作为开源内存数据存储不仅限于缓存,还是数据库、事件存储、消息代理、内存数据存储、AI功能存储、AI和搜索解决方案,使我们能够构建超低延迟和高吞吐量的实时应用程序。
本文总结了Ofer Bengal(Redis Labs联合创始人兼首席执行官)和Yiftach Shoolman(联合创始人兼CTO)发表的RedisConf 2021主题演讲中的主要内容:
专注于机器学习和人工智能

  • RedisAI将数据作为存储(功能存储)提供给AI驱动的应用程序,以执行深度学习/机器学习模型并管理其数据
  • 支持AI用例,例如视觉搜索,评论等。
  • Redis逐渐成为AI应用程序的在线功能存储-还包括功能存储,模型存储和模型推断。

 
使用Redis最受欢迎的模块来构建创新产品

 
REDIS –实时系统的事实上的标准
  • 延迟感知和超快速(亚毫秒级响应时间)实时应用程序
  • 自由使用任何数据模型来构建您的应用程序
  • 通过高可用性,复制,自动故障转移,可扩展的Redis模块(如RedisRaft) 对状态状态应用程序进行实时访问数据–一种新的强一致性部署选项

 
REDIS部署灵活选项
Redis支持的部署选项的共享更新(尤其是使用Redis Enterprise Cloud –托管云服务):
  • 选项#1 –只读副本
  • 选项#2 –其他分布式数据库(DynamoDB,Cosmos)+ Redis
  • 选项#3 – Active-Active Redis(宣布嵌套数据类型-RedisJSON&RedisSearch支持CRDB –无冲突的复制数据库